Hi, everybody!
I did ask Linus this question once upon a time and got an answer that it does not got rid of 'coz nobody insisted. I did but with no result. Now I'd like to ask this question again. I mean kernel boot error messages when changing root from initrd to the real root. Those messages seems don't make any harm, but it's not a good thing to have them in kernel logs anyway. This is my recent kernel (2.2.10-ac5) log excerpt:
